While there isn’t a definitive rule, current trends suggest the following optimal booking periods:
30–45 days prior
Booking too early or too close can raise expenses.
2–4 months ahead
Significant fare increases happen as dates approach.
3–6 months ahead
Early booking is crucial as these slots get expensive fast.
Often unreliable, only applicable to less popular routes.
Sticking to these guidelines enhances your chances of finding affordable fares.
Prices fluctuate daily due to demand and business travel habits.
• Typically, mid-week (Tuesday to Thursday) shows more balanced pricing.
• Mondays often see spikes due to business travel.
• Weekends can lead to increased searches but not always lower rates.
• Friday evenings might offer slight discounts as demand changes.
These are broader trends rather than fixed rules.
The choice of travel days often bears more significance than booking timing.

Budget airlines can offer significant savings when navigated correctly.
• Lower base ticket costs
• Additional fees for luggage
• Charges associated with seat selection
These carriers are best utilized by light packers who adhere to their guidelines.
